Lot description: Roman Provincial PISIDIA, Termessus Major. Pseudo-autonomous issue. Early 3rd century AD. Æ 23mm (7.87 g, 7h). Draped bust of Hermes right, kerykeion over shoulder / Apollo Kitharoidos standing facing, head left, holding branch and folds of drapery. SNG France 2181-3; cf. SNG Copenhagen 320; SNG von Aulock 5348. VF, red and brown patina. From the J.P. Righetti Collection, 9725. Estimate: $100 |
